Summary

NESO publishes real-time data on upcoming electricity trades for balancing the grid, showing energy trades planned for delivery. The dataset updates every ten minutes and displays trades made to meet forecast balancing requirements at minimum cost.

Why it matters

Provides transparency into NESO's balancing actions and forward trading positions, helping market participants understand system balancing patterns and anticipate grid operator interventions.
